Zeniarai Benzaiten Ugafuku Shrine
Kamakura, Japan
π Shrine
A unique Shinto shrine hidden in a cave-like grotto in the hills of Kamakura. Visitors wash their money in the shrine's spring water, believing it will multiply their wealth. Founded in 1185 by Minamoto no Yoritomo, the atmospheric approach through a rock tunnel adds to its mystical charm.
